“Drug Scandal Rocks Vietnamese Football: 5 Players Suspended After Failed Tests”

Five prominent football players have been banned from participating in national tournaments organized by the VFF due to their alleged involvement in drug-related activities. The players, including goalkeeper Duong Quang Tuan, center-back Nguyen Ngoc Thang, and midfielders Dinh Thanh Trung, Nguyen Van Truong, and Nguyen Trung Hoc, are currently in police custody as the investigation unfolds. The situation came to light last Saturday when police raided a local hotel in Ha Tinh Province. The five players were found in the company of a group suspected of drug-related activities, leading to their immediate suspension from football activities. Among the players, Dinh Thanh Trung, a former member of the Vietnamese national team, was the recipient of the Vietnam Golden Ball in 2017. Nguyen Ngoc Thang, another talented player, had recently represented the U23 Vietnam team in the AFC U23 Asian Cup 2024 quarterfinals in Qatar. List of sports bring most gold medals for Vietnamese athletes at SEA Games 32

Hình ảnh
The Vietnamese martial arts teams can be seen as gold mine at any SEA Games, with this year’s edition being no exception. The nation’s wushu team secures six gold, three silver, and two bronze medals at SEA Games 32. Vietnamese karate fighters pocket six gold medals, leading the medal tally for karate at SEA Games 32. Local martial artists win a total of six gold medals, placing second in the Kun Bokator, a traditional battlefield martial art of Cambodia, medal tally at the regional games this year. The national Vovinam team maintain their strengths at the regional competition after bringing home seven gold medals. With seven gold, three silver, and seven bronze medals, local swimmers rank second in terms of the medal table behind Singapore. Photo exhibition shows Uncle Ho’s love for Hanoi

Hình ảnh
Ho Chi Minh was always interested in culture, education, and respect for talent. Although he was swamped with work as a president, he visited Van Mieu-Quoc Tu Giam, an icon of Vietnamese intelligentsia, three times (1945, 1960 and 1962). The photo was taken during his visit on January 26, 1960. The inscription of the examination held in 1442 reads: “Virtuous and talented men are the original vitality of a state”. President Ho Chi Minh inherited the tradition of honoring talented people in the nation’s history and developed new conditions for treating talents. During his lifetime, he often said, “We must cultivate talented people” because “nation-building needs talented people”. President Ho Chi Minh inspired many talented people to participate in the liberation and reconstruction of the country.
